Proof of Delivery (POD) is a crucial document or electronic record in shipping and delivery that confirms that goods have reached their destination and been received by the customer. It's like a receipt that proves a package was delivered successfully. This can be a physical signature on paper, an electronic signature on a device, or even a photo of the delivered package. Companies use POD systems to track deliveries, handle customer disputes, and ensure smooth operations in their shipping processes. You might also hear it called "delivery confirmation" or "POD documentation."

Q: What are the essential elements of a good Proof of Delivery system?
Expected Answer: Should mention clear documentation, time stamps, recipient information, condition of goods, photo evidence if applicable, and proper storage of records.

Q: What information should be collected on a POD form?
Expected Answer: Should list basic requirements like date, time, recipient name, signature, delivery address, and any notes about the condition of delivered items.
